HV52A35048000812100The BEGE Flange Encoder MIG Nova+ MN-350-48-0008-12, 8 pulses, 100m cable, aluminium is an incremental encoder with high resolution and improved signal stability, designed for precise control in automated systems. Key attributes: BCD: 300, flange outer diameter: 350mm, flange thickness: 12mm, shaft diameter: 48mm, IEC norm: 180B5, material: aluminium, IP rating: IP55/IP67, input voltage: 5–24VDC, output: A90°B / A'90°B' HTL/TTL, pulses per revolution: 8 per channel, cable length: 100m. Suitable for precise feedback in automated control tasks.

BEGE Power Transmission is a renowned Dutch manufacturer known for its high-quality solutions in the field of drive and automation technology. With a focus on reliability, innovation, and durability, BEGE encoders are specifically designed to meet the requirements of demanding industrial and engineering applications.Product Name: BEGE Flanged Encoder MIG Nova+ MN-350-48-0008-12Key Features and Advantages:
High-Resolution Incremental Encoder: Designed for applications requiring precise speed and position feedback, enabling better control and accuracy in automated systems.
Enhanced Signal Stability: Provides improved signal integrity, minimizing errors and ensuring reliable performance even in demanding industrial environments.
Robust Aluminium Housing: The encoder is built with an aluminium body, offering excellent corrosion resistance and mechanical protection for long-term industrial use.
Large Flange Diameter (Ø350mm) and Shaft (48mm): Compatible with large motors and machinery, providing secure mounting and stable operation.
Wide Voltage Input Range (5–24VDC): Flexible integration into various control systems and power supplies.
Long Cable Length (100m): Suitable for installations where the encoder is positioned far from the control cabinet, reducing signal loss over long distances.
Multiple Output Signals (A 90° B / A’ 90° B’ HTL/TTL): Maximizes compatibility with many modern drive and automation control systems.
Pulse Rate: 8 pulses per channel per revolution, ideal for applications where basic incremental feedback with high signal clarity is needed.
High IP Classification (IP55/IP67): Ensures protection against dust and water, supporting use in harsh industrial settings.
Complies with IEC 180B5 Standards: Standardized for easy replacement and universal motor flange compatibility.
Flange Thickness (12mm) and BCD 300mm: Designed to match industry-standard mounting requirements for seamless installation.Application Possibilities:
Precision speed and position feedback in automated production lines, conveyors, and packaging machinery.
Suitable for integration in motor feedback systems for improved dynamic performance in robotics and machine tools.
Optimal for environments requiring high reliability, durability, and signal integrity across long cable runs.
Engineered for use by technical specialists and engineers in advanced industrial automation projects.
